SQl before edit - RESOLVED in code
Is there a way to set up a SQL backend stored procedure that will not allow a record to be edited if the date is before a specified date?
It is an accounting type issue.
I want to have a table with one date in it (accounting date) that represents the date the books are officially closed for the month.
I want a procedure for the INVOICE table that will not allow any VB.net windows forms to edit records with a date < accounting date. Kind of a Before-Edit function that checks the date of the record.
I can do it in the VB.net program but I am having trouble with the grid forms and allowing some records to be edited and others to not be edited.
I will need to use the same functionality on the JOURNAL, TIME, and PARTIALS tables also. Doing it at the server level will help by not having to duplicate code over 8 similar forms.
